Facemadics exists to create and sell unique stationery, photographs, and hand-made prints THE ARTIST. Jabari Mason, aka Diamond Axe, began Facemadics in 2005 after exploring black and white, hand-drawn faces inspired by the masked heroes in his favorite childhood cartoons.
